Tennyson wrote "The Charge of the Light Brigade" to memorialize a British attack at the end of the Crimean War. The attack was ill-fated and unnecessary, given that (unknown to the brigade) the nations involved had agreed to a truce.

Why is he known as Alfred Lord Tennyson not Lord Tennyson or Lord Alfred Tennyson?

'Lord Alfred' would indicate noble birth. Tennyson was promoted into the peerage. 'Lord Tennyson' would also be a correct usage in his case.
